MANILA – The PBA fined Magnolia forward Calvin Abueva P100,000 for mocking the physical disability of San Miguel head coach Jorge Gallent in Game 2 of the 2023-24 PBA Commissioner's Cup Finals.

The league announced the development Tuesday ahead of Game 3 the next day at the Araneta Coliseum in Quezon City.

PBA said its league rules state that "any person who offends the dignity of any person on account of 'physical disability' shall be subject to a fine not lower than P 100,000," hence the penalty.

Gallent has accepted Abueva's apology, PBA said, after reaching out to the San Miguel mentor later that night after the incident.

No suspensions were handed to the 6-foot-2 forward, who has served a hefty suspension before which lasted for about 16 months for unfortunate confrontations involving TNT import Terrence Jones and the then-girlfriend of Bobby Ray Parks Jr.

Meanwhile, Abueva and the wife of SMB forward Mo Tautuaa have patched things up, said Commissioner Willie Marcial.

As tensions rose after the match, the two engaged in a verbal spat beyond the court.

Due to the altercation, they were summoned by the commissioner earlier Tuesday, PBA said.

Marcial said Abueva and Tautuaa's wife settled the issue after talking things over.

"Abueva apologized to the PBA and to Tautuaa and his wife. Nagkausap at nagkaayos na sila," the league commissioner said.

They were also given warning that "repetition of such incidents will be dealt with a heavier penalty."
